The strategy is for people to adopt a different major or semi-major street and take measurements every mile or so for the length of the street (or for as long as they can). If you have joined scistarter, you can get the app for free. It is easy to find Perseus by either looking southward from Cassiopeia or just to the left of Taurus the Bull. Take Part: Join the … Sign up to be an Adopt-a-Street coordinator for your city! The legs of Perseus are pointing southward and are the forked part of the wishbone and the body and head are the straight line leading up northward. The Globe at Night project seeks to raise awareness about increasing light pollution and quantify it by having citizen scientists measure the darkness of the sky near them. Light pollution not only wastes billions of dollars a year in energy and money but it causes human sleep disorders and disrupts habits critical to ecology.
